History & Origin
Doreen is an -een elaboration of Dora — from Greek doron, 'a gift' (a short form of Dorothea, 'gift of God') — and it also reflects the Irish Doirean, variously 'sullen, brooding' or 'a gift' (routes layered, which we note). A soft, vintage, early-20th-century name (said 'dor-EEN'; nickname Dora).
It registers thinly today. Rare now, a-gift at the root, and vintage.

Frequently Asked
What does the name Doreen mean?
Doreen elaborates Dora ('a gift', Greek), and reflects the Irish Doirean; the routes are layered.
How do you pronounce Doreen?
It's said dor-EEN /dɔrˈin/ — two syllables, stress on the second.
Is Doreen a boy or girl name?
Doreen is a girl's name.
How popular is Doreen?
Doreen is a rare name in the U.S. today.
